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Carle Place Middle Senior High School is situated in the residential community of Carle Place, a hamlet within the Town of North Hempstead on Long Island, New York. The school is centrally located along Cherry Lane, offering easy access from major thoroughfares. The primary access routes include the Northern State Parkway and the Meadowbrook Parkway, both of which are a short drive away and connect to wider Long Island and New York City road networks. Parking directly at the school is generally available in designated lots, but can become congested during major athletic events or school activities. The nearest major airport serving Carle Place is John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) and LaGuardia Airport (LGA), both approximately a 30-45 minute drive away depending on traffic conditions. Long Island MacArthur Airport (ISP) is also an option, usually a bit further east. Public transportation is available via the Long Island Rail Road (LIRR), with the Carle Place station being a short walk or very brief taxi/rideshare from the high school. For those driving, it is advisable to arrive at least 30-45 minutes prior to event start times to allow for parking and pedestrian movement around the school grounds, especially during peak hours. Rideshare services can be a convenient alternative for direct drop-offs near the school entrance.

Cradle of Aviation Museum

2.5 mi

Located within Mitchell Field Park, this museum is dedicated to the history of aviation, with a particular focus on Long Island's role in aeronautical development. It houses a significant collection of aircraft and exhibits covering various eras of flight, from early balloons to space exploration. The museum also features a planetarium and IMAX theater, offering engaging experiences for all ages. It’s an excellent option for educational exploration and entertainment, especially on days with less favorable weather.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Carle Place brings cold temperatures, with average highs in the 30s and 40s Fahrenheit.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of footwear, especially for outdoor events. Days are shorter, and early darkness can affect visibility around campus. Dress in layers to remain comfortable if moving between indoor and outdoor spaces.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ring weather is variable, ranging from cool to mild, with average temperatures from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it. Layers are recommended, as mornings can be crisp and afternoons pleasantly warm. Brief rain showers are common, so carrying a light, waterproof jacket or umbrella is advisable. Outdoor activities are generally pleasant, though unexpected cool fronts can occur.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er typically brings warm to hot and humid conditions, with daily highs often in the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Light, breathable clothing like shorts, t-shirts, and sundresses are best. Staying hydrated is crucial, and sunscreen is highly recommended for any outdoor activities. Shaded areas or indoor venues are preferred during the hottest parts of the day.

🍂

Fall season

Fall offers crisp air and mild temperatures, usually ranging from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it, making it ideal for outdoor sporting events. As the season progresses, temperatures can drop significantly, so packing sweaters, light jackets, and perhaps a warmer coat is wise. The foliage can be beautiful, but mornings and evenings can be quite cool.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is possible throughout the year but is most common in spring and fall. Visitors should always be prepared with an umbrella or rain gear. Winter can bring snow, which may cause travel delays or require adjustments to outdoor event schedules. Check local weather advisories and school announcements for any weather-related disruptions to planned activities.
